Hey Priya — handing over the Quillbase static-analysis setup. Heads up: the baseline file (`sa-baseline.yml`) suppresses about 140 legacy findings so new PRs stay clean. Don't let anyone add fresh suppressions without a ticket — that's the whole game. I've been burning down roughly ten entries a sprint. The suppression policy and the burn-down tracker are on the page below.

runbook for fajep-yahop: https://rundeck.braskdata.example/repo/run/pages/job/dfe5b8c563356906

### Deploy Step 3 — ParityScope

Build the ParityScope checker image from the release branch. Run the smoke suite against the Harlow staging cluster; all rate-diff fixtures must pass. Do not skip the currency-normalization check — stale FX tables cause false parity alerts. Push the image to the internal registry. Registry pushes must be signed. Use the key below.

signing key of bagap-yawep = bky13_TbfT6ZMUoGJo2

Subject: Cut-over done — Pebblepay retry keys

Hi Ansa,

Cut-over went smoothly last night. Idempotency keys are now minted by Pebblepay's gateway itself, so duplicate retries collapse server-side and the old client-side hack is gone. Two stale retries got absorbed cleanly during the window. The new gateway is live with the following configuration values.

settings of tagef-bawif:
DRUIX_HOST=druix.zemvarlabs.internal
DRUIX_PORT=8000

## Further reading

The Ladleworks scaling calculator takes untrusted recipe input, so review the quantity parser closely — it evaluates unit expressions and has had injection issues before. Fraction handling and locale-specific separators are the other hot spots. Prior audit findings, the parser's grammar spec, and the fuzzing corpus are collected on the internal page below.

runbook for tajep-yahig: https://artifactory.lumictech.corp/repo